movie-style popcorn
by taira
coconut oil is used in theaters because it's rich, has a high smoke point, and is shelf-stable while not requiring refrigeration. Flavacol is used to give it that buttery, salty flavor if you want to add more color, you can use coconut oil with beta carotene

in a pot over medium heat add the oil and 3 kernels. Once the kernels have popped, we know the oil has reached the desired temperature
add the rest of the kernels and flavacol. Mix to combine and cover with a lid but leave it slightly ajar so steam can escape
once the popcorn start popping, gently shake the pot occasionally to prevent burning. When popping slows to several seconds between pops, remove from heat.
Pour the popcorn into a large bowl. Add extra seasoning as desired
